EEA: small increase in EU’s total greenhouse gas emissions in 2017, with transport emissions up for the fourth consecutive year

Green Car Congress

Total greenhouse gas emissions in the European Union (EU) increased by 0.7% in 2017, according to latest official data published today by the European Environment Agency (EEA). in 2017 compared with 2016. From 1990 to 2017, the EU reduced its net greenhouse gas emissions by 21.7%. Source: EEA.

T&E: Electric bus orders in Europe more than doubled to 1,031 units in 2017; ~9% share of new registrations

Green Car Congress

The number of battery-electric buses ordered in Europe more than doubled in 2017 compared to 2016, reaching 1,031 vehicles, according to a new analysis by environmental NGO Transport & Environment. The Netherlands, UK, France, Poland and Germany account for more than half the total number of electric buses in Europe (including orders).
